<p>I haven&#8217;t written for the last two days.  Neither have I missed writing for the last two days.  Frankly, I&#8217;m utterly exhausted and my well of creativity has been wrung dry.  So I&#8217;m officially taking a break.</p>
<p>This doesn&#8217;t mean that I&#8217;m not thinking about writing.  I have been, a lot.  I&#8217;ve been reading a bunch of blogs and articles on writing advice (which I shall link to sometime soon) and contemplating process.</p>
<p>My process has always been this: I am a pantser.  I get an idea, and I work with it with no plan, just trying to excavate the relic hidden beneath the earth.  And I rewrite and rewrite and rewrite.</p>
<p>Anyone who&#8217;s been reading my blog entries will know by now how frustrated I&#8217;ve been with this process.  It doesn&#8217;t mesh with my innate nature, which is someone who likes to plan and organise.  And so I think it&#8217;s time for me to try something different.  Not now, but when I come back to writing again after the sprog is born and life has settled down again.</p>
<p>I am going to try to become a plotter.</p>
<p>At the moment, I&#8217;m unsure as to what method of plotting I&#8217;ll use.  I have plenty of time to explore them, so that doesn&#8217;t worry me right now.  I&#8217;m also going to try to get myself back into a writing routine as soon as I can.  This may be the more ambitious part of the plan, but it&#8217;s always been the best way for me.  I&#8217;m also going to seriously track the time that I spend writing and set myself deadlines.  And yes, I will probably blog endlessly about this entire process.</p>
